By Warren Strobel MUSCAT/BEIJING (Reuters) - The United States, Iran and Europe were weighing their next moves on Tuesday after two days of nuclear talks failed to produce any apparent breakthrough ahead of a Nov. 24 deadline. Iran's top negotiator, Deputy Foreign Minister Abbas Araqchi, described the talks in Oman as "two days of very hard work", the official IRNA news agency reported. *** "We are still not in a position to claim that progress is achieved, although I cannot say that it was no good, either," he added. ...
